
Alex
03.09.2016
17:15:24
никогда не юзал эту штуку кстати.

Nikolay
03.09.2016
17:15:24
думал на раскладку, думал на буфер обмена
в sqlite пускало
и в постгрю тоже пускало раньше

Google

Nikolay
03.09.2016
17:15:51
а сейчас виснет на запросе пароля
странно короче

ojab
03.09.2016
17:19:19
spring попробуй перезапустить

Adamtsov
03.09.2016
17:19:43
Я rails db не изал никогда
А что она делает ?)

Nikolay
03.09.2016
17:19:48
удобно
просто в бд тебя загоняет
чтоб ті в ней напрямую ковірялся
от херня. постгревый клиент тоже почему-то замирает

Adamtsov
03.09.2016
17:21:28
Так psql db_name --U username

Nikolay
03.09.2016
17:21:45
с хостом, да
я тут сижу думаю как на основе редиса намонстрячить лив сеарч

ojab
03.09.2016
17:22:21
ну и да, попробуй bundle exec rails dbconsole #{ENV} -p

Google

Nikolay
03.09.2016
17:22:32
чтобы постгрю не трахать

Alex
03.09.2016
17:22:56
а не проше elastic/solr?

Alex
03.09.2016
17:22:57
у тебя докер, тебе все равно

Nikolay
03.09.2016
17:23:06
не
у меня нет таких мощных тазиков. еластику самум от полтора надо

Alex
03.09.2016
17:23:29
что

Nikolay
03.09.2016
17:23:31
bundle exec rails dbconsole #{ENV} -p
/home/mulder/.rbenv/versions/2.3.1/lib/ruby/gems/2.3.0/gems/railties-4.2.6/lib/rails/railtie/configuration.rb:95
:in `method_missing': undefined method `web_console' for #<Rails::Application::Configuration:0x00564ef1df2a50> (NoMethodError)
Did you mean? console

ojab
03.09.2016
17:23:50
вместо env свой env подставь
хм

Nikolay
03.09.2016
17:24:24
ххм
bundle exec rails db development -p
psql (9.4.8, server 9.5.4)
WARNING: psql major version 9.4, server major version 9.5.
Some psql features might not work.
SSL connection (protocol: TLSv1.2, cipher: ECDHE-RSA-AES256-GCM-SHA384, bits: 256, compression: off)
Type "help" for help.
w3dhcp_development=#
а так пустило

ojab
03.09.2016
17:24:54
dbconsole чтоль только в пятёрке появилась

Nikolay
03.09.2016
17:24:55
а с родным постгревым клиентом таже херня

ojab
03.09.2016
17:25:01
ну да, в общем ключ -p

Nikolay
03.09.2016
17:25:23
rails db -p
psql (9.4.8, server 9.5.4)
WARNING: psql major version 9.4, server major version 9.5.
Some psql features might not work.
SSL connection (protocol: TLSv1.2, cipher: ECDHE-RSA-AES256-GCM-SHA384, bits: 256, compression: off)
Type "help" for help.

Nikolay
03.09.2016
17:25:28

Nikolay
03.09.2016
17:26:01
db же
а не dbconsole

Google

Nikolay
03.09.2016
17:26:24
видимо db алиас
и в rails —help написано dbconsole

Nikolay
03.09.2016
17:27:42
а я везде видел как дб без консоль )
добрался в базу и ладно. уже забыл зачем правла
ILIKE вот хотел..

Danila
03.09.2016
17:29:42
зачем тебе в базе ковыряться?

Alex
03.09.2016
17:29:56

Danila
03.09.2016
17:30:10
чёт не вижу
где?

Nikolay
03.09.2016
17:30:20
вообще я думаю на тему того как его к редису прикрутить

Alex
03.09.2016
17:30:25

Nikolay
03.09.2016
17:30:25
на тему livesearch

Alex
03.09.2016
17:30:44
Как прикрутить с редису то для чего предназначен эластик

Danila
03.09.2016
17:30:49
не вижу где он писал это
и зачем для этого подключение к базе тоже не вижу

Nikolay
03.09.2016
17:31:03
с час назад
с полтора если быть точным

Danila
03.09.2016
17:32:01
так зачем подключение к базе
?

Nikolay
03.09.2016
17:32:19

Google

Alex
03.09.2016
17:32:37
причем тут редис то?

Alex
03.09.2016
17:32:50
Я не хочу изучать ассемблер, уже есть машинные коды

Nikolay
03.09.2016
17:32:55

Nikolay
03.09.2016
17:33:17
чувак, такое надо делать в тестах, закрой консоль бд

Danila
03.09.2016
17:33:29
кек
и что ты хочешь этим сказать?

Alex
03.09.2016
17:33:41

Nikolay
03.09.2016
17:33:49

Alex
03.09.2016
17:34:05
Я кстати не понимаю что ты собрался делать в тесте если ты еще с SQL не поиграл

Nikolay
03.09.2016
17:34:07

Admin
ERROR: S client not available

Nikolay
03.09.2016
17:34:17

Nikolay
03.09.2016
17:34:19
в списке людей, повлиявших на твою жизнь?

Alex
03.09.2016
17:34:23
Т.е чтобы что то сделать нужно хотя бы понимать
а пока ты в консоли с запросом не поиграешь толку то от того что ты это в тесте делаешь? в консорльке быстрее разобраться, там голый SQL

Danila
03.09.2016
17:34:51
зачем подключение к базе скажите?

Nikolay
03.09.2016
17:35:22

Alex
03.09.2016
17:35:34
Обожаю такие ответы!
сказал как ничего не сказал.

Danila
03.09.2016
17:35:54
сам не знаешь зачем кароч

Google

Nikolay
03.09.2016
17:36:30
изначально хотел посмотреть на ilike/pgtrgm

Nikolay
03.09.2016
17:36:59
ну так юзай rails c
ты же будешь это юзать в итоге из руби

Alex
03.09.2016
17:37:59

Nikolay
03.09.2016
17:39:01
кстати разницы между like/ilike я поверхностно не нашел

Nikolay
03.09.2016
17:39:10
в регистре

ojab
03.09.2016
17:39:34
case-insensitive

Nikolay
03.09.2016
17:39:41
а
спаисбо, буду знать
чо нашел https://github.com/huacnlee/redis-search

Alex
03.09.2016
17:43:10
спелчек как прикручивать будешь?
и стемминг как делать будешь?

Nikolay
03.09.2016
17:44:02
что есть стемминг?
а спелчек - вввел говно - получи ничего ))

Alex
03.09.2016
17:45:12
https://github.com/huacnlee/redis-search/wiki/Usage-in-Chinese
???

Alex
03.09.2016
17:45:23
вводишь "моло" получаешь "молоко"

Adamtsov
03.09.2016
17:45:29
Заюзай гем ransack

Nikolay
03.09.2016
17:45:55
мне и надо молоко получить, в общемто
строить еще одну таблицу в постгре.. брр

Adamtsov
03.09.2016
17:46:39
Ты про ransack ?

Nikolay
03.09.2016
17:46:49
с тем же успехом я могу сходить в оригинальную таблицу
ага

Alex
03.09.2016
17:47:08
ты записи в таблице как будто руками обновляешь из колбеков